  1. I was sleeved on 9/15. On 9/29, after I met with my NUT, I was told I could eat ground meats, canned shicken, and canned tuna. The most at each meal is 4 ounces. The first 4 days I could not get in more than 2 ounces per meal, so then I had to make up with Protein drink. Today I managed to eat 4 ounces for lunch and dinner each, and I feel stuffed for hours. I am really missing veggies.

  4. I was sleeved on the 15th and had bad nausea. On the 17th got to go home and that was a huge positive for my morale. I have been able to take in liquids quite easily. Really watching my blood sugar since it has been very low, so I think I will take myself off the very last pill as of today. I would prefer my readings to be on the high side right now.

    For dinner tonight I am going to have cream of chicken Soup and am so looking forward to something that is not sweet.

    My incisions do not hurt but they are starting to itch like crazy. I actually slept on my stomach last night and that made me very happy.
